使用javascript的RegExp对象(正则)
2012-03-21 11:06
281 查看
<html>
<head runat="server">
<title></title>
<script language="javascript" type="text/javascript">
//使用正则表达式的test方法,检验是否含有某个特定的字符
function Ftest() {
var v = new RegExp("chai");
var flag = v.test("I am chai weiwei");
alert(flag);
}
//使用正则表达式的exec方法,输出要检验的特定字符
function Fexec() {
var v = new RegExp("chai");
var result = v.exec("I am chai weiwei");
alert(result);
}
//使用正则表达式的compile方法
function Fcompile() {
var v = new RegExp("chai");
var flag1 = v.test("I am chai weiwei");
v = v.compile("cai");
var falg2 = v.test("I am chai weiwei");
alert(flag1+"&"+falg2)
}
</script>
</head>
<body>
<form id="form1" runat="server">
<div>
<input type="button" value="RegExp的test方法" onclick="Ftest()" /><br />
<input type="button" value="RegExp的exec方法" onclick="Fexec()" /><br />
<input type="button" value="RegExp的compile方法" onclick="Fcompile()" /><br />
</div>
</form>
</body>
</html>
<head runat="server">
<title></title>
<script language="javascript" type="text/javascript">
//使用正则表达式的test方法,检验是否含有某个特定的字符
function Ftest() {
var v = new RegExp("chai");
var flag = v.test("I am chai weiwei");
alert(flag);
}
//使用正则表达式的exec方法,输出要检验的特定字符
function Fexec() {
var v = new RegExp("chai");
var result = v.exec("I am chai weiwei");
alert(result);
}
//使用正则表达式的compile方法
function Fcompile() {
var v = new RegExp("chai");
var flag1 = v.test("I am chai weiwei");
v = v.compile("cai");
var falg2 = v.test("I am chai weiwei");
alert(flag1+"&"+falg2)
}
</script>
</head>
<body>
<form id="form1" runat="server">
<div>
<input type="button" value="RegExp的test方法" onclick="Ftest()" /><br />
<input type="button" value="RegExp的exec方法" onclick="Fexec()" /><br />
<input type="button" value="RegExp的compile方法" onclick="Fcompile()" /><br />
</div>
</form>
</body>
</html>
相关文章推荐
- JavaScript中的String对象的常用方法、文本框对象的常用方法和事件、正则表达式的概念、正则表达式的几种构造方式、RegExp对象使用什么方法匹配正则表达式、
- 浅谈JS正则表达式的RegExp对象和括号的使用
- Javascript中的“正则表达式对象”与“全局RegExp对象”
- Javascript RegExp 常用正则使用收集
- JavaScript RegExp(正则表达式) 对象
- JavaScript对象之正则表达式-RegExp
- JavaScript语法入门系列(七) 类和对象(正则表达式RegExp)
- JavaScript的对象及正则(RegExp)对象
- JavaScript-RegExp对象只能使用一次问题解决方法
- JavaScript之基础-10 JavaScript 正则表达式(概述、定义正则、RegExp对象、用于模式匹配的String方法)
- 好好学一遍JavaScript 笔记(七)——RegExp对象与常用正则
- JavaScript RegExp (正则表达式对象)
- JavaScript-RegExp对象只能使用一次问题解决方法
- JavaScript中正则表达式RegExp对象的test方法
- 好好学一遍JavaScript 笔记(七)——RegExp对象与常用正则
- JavaScript 正则表达式对象RegExp test方法慎用/g
- JavaScript中String对象的match()、replace() 配合正则表达式使用
- [ASP]RegExp对象提供简单的正则表达式支持功能使用说明
- JavaScript对象之正则表达式-RegExp
- JavaScript RegExp 正则表达式对象详细说明